Output 494372398fc50da42358f54361bcda72f191cee27ddb94ada26aeff59bff0d9b:1

value
22015663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427672eb30daffed15d1381a3e4208ba3cb2a66b OP_EQUAL
address
37kSRBJj8m26Xf6343EkDxbykk6pkjyH8s
transaction
494372398fc50da42358f54361bcda72f191cee27ddb94ada26aeff59bff0d9b
spent
true